Fortune Jet - CG and control throws.
Ive had many people ask me to check my CG and throws, so i finally put the Fortune on the Xicoy CG meter.
This is with everything loaded, UAT full and main tank empty.
The CG which the meter is reading (90mm in front of main wheels with springs retracted) equals about 260mm back from leading edge wing joint.
I hope you guys benefit from there numbers, as you can see she flys just fine
Control throws:
Flaps: takeoff 40mm, landing 97mm.
Ailerons: 31mm up, 20mm down, 40% expo.
Elevators: 33mm up, 28mm down, expo 40%.
Rudder: 60mm, 40% expo.
